Bandeau

Site de démonstration du jeu de squelettes ESCAL fonctionnant sous SPIP3 et mis à la disposition des Etablissements SColaires de l’Académie de Lyon... et de qui veut.

Forum de l’article

Annuaire de sites

Qui êtes-vous ?
Votre message

Pour créer des paragraphes, laissez simplement des lignes vides.
Attention ! Si votre message contient un lien, il devra être validé par le webmestre.

Ajouter un document

Rappel de la discussion
Une pétition sans annuaire est-ce possible ?
Rv2mars - le 23 octobre 2018

Bonjour Jean Christophe,
d’abord un grand merci pour ce squelette plein de ressources et de possibilités :)

Je souhaite mettre en ligne une pétition, j’ai bien suivi toute la procédure décrite dans la page annuaire.
Cela fonctionne pour faire un annuaire de sites.

Mais en fait je souhaite que les personnes puissent signer une pétition sans avoir à indiquer un site web, car il ne s’agit pas de faire un annuaire de sites, mais de recueillir des signatures pour une simple pétition.

Et dans ce cas, j’ai bien les signatures visibles dans l’espace privé, mais si les signataires n’indiquent pas de site web leurs signatures n’apparaissent pas sur la page publique de l’annuaire (ce qui est logique pour un annuaire, mais moins pratique pour publier une pétition et ses signataires).

Y a-t-il un autre moyen de mettre une pétition en ligne ?

Merci d’avance et longue vie à Escal.

Une pétition sans annuaire est-ce possible ?
Jean Christophe Villeneuve - le 23 octobre 2018

Hello

J’ai remonté ta réponse comme nouveau sujet 😉

On peut faire ce que tu souhaites en faisant ceci

  • dans l’article qui sert de base, tu décoches "indiquer obligatoirement un site web"
  • tu copies les 2 fichiers signature.html et signature.php de /escal/formulaires vers /squelettes/formulaires (dossier à créer si pas existant)
  • dans le fichier signature.html copié, tu supprimes les lignes 29 à 43 pour ne plus demander de site web dans le formumaire
  • tu copies le fichier annuaire.html dans /squelettes
  • dans ce fichier annuaire.html copié, tu remplaces la boucle signature existante par celle-ci
                                  <BOUCLE_signatures(SIGNATURES) {recherche ?#ENV{recherche_signatures}} {id_article} {!par date} {pagination 5}>
                                  <li>
                                  <p class="nom"><small>[<a class="spip_mail" href="mailto:#AD_EMAIL" title="#AD_EMAIL">(#NOM)</a>]
                      </small></p>
                                  [<p class="#EDIT{message} message">(#MESSAGE|PtoBR|supprimer_tags|couper{600})</p>]
                                  </li>
                                  </BOUCLE_signatures>
  • tu admires le résultat 😎

Et si tu veux améliorer et que tu ne sais pas faire, n’hésite pas à demander.

Derniers commentaires

Modifier un texte
Ok c’était bien ça, cool. A l’avenir, utilises plutôt un éditeur de code plutôt que LibreOffice, (...)

Modifier un texte - suite et fin -
Super, c’est réparé Les apostrophes inclinés venaient de LibreOffice ! Encore (...)

Modifier un texte
Hello Je pencherais pour les apostrophes qui sont incurvées au lieu d’être droites car je ne vois (...)

Modifier un texte
Le fichier ci-dessous déposé dans le répertoire lang ne passe pas. "Parse error : syntax error, (...)

images dans un article
Bonjour Jean Christophe, non, je n’ai pas accès à ce fichier ; le répertoire /config ne m’est pas (...)

Plan du site Contact Mentions légales Données personnelles et cookies Espace privé squelette RSS

2009-2024 © Escal - Tous droits réservés
Haut de page
Réalisé sous SPIP
Habillage ESCAL 4.6.2